Administrative Assistant
Responsibilities Job Summary/Responsibilities: Responsible for providing administrative and clerical support to the executive officer(s); duties are generally more complex in nature and involve access to confidential information. Represents division and interacts with high level stakeholders; other associated duties may include but not limited to secretarial activities such as drafting correspondence and memos, scheduling appointments, taking minutes and making travel arrangements, etc. Typical Physical Demands: Essential: sitting, walking, stooping/bending, finger dexterity, seeing, hearing, speaking. Frequent: standing, lifting usual weight up to 25 pounds; carrying usual weight of 5 pounds up to 20 pounds; reaching above, at and below shoulder level; repetitive arm/hand motions. walking. Occasional: climbing stairs, twisting body, pushing/pulling. Operates computer, printer, copier, facsimile machine, telephone and other office equipment. Typical Working Conditions: Not substantially subjected to adverse environmental conditions. Minimum Qualifications: A. Education/Certification and Licensure: Associate's degree or business school graduate or two (2) years of administrative experience may be substituted for the degree. B. Experience: In addition to educational requirement, five (5) years experience as a secretary at an administrative/executive level in a corporate environment. Prior experience in a hospital or health care setting and working knowledge of medical terminology highly desirable. Prior experience working with physicians, trustees, community organizations and with individuals at a high organizational level in a courteous, helpful and professional manner. Supervisory experience preferred. Experience to demonstrate the following: o Proficiency to use Outlook, MS Word, Excel, and PowerPoint. o Effectively communicates both orally and in writing. o Collaborative spirit, results driven with the ability to manage multiple priorities and projects with a high degree of accuracy and timeliness.
